6+ Free Tableau Alternative: Open Source BI Tools


6+ Free Tableau Alternative: Open Source BI Tools

Solutions providing business intelligence and data visualization functionalities without proprietary licensing represent a segment of the software market. These options often allow users to access, modify, and distribute the software’s source code, promoting community-driven development and customization. A prominent example is Apache Superset, a web application designed for data exploration and visualization through a user-friendly interface.

The significance of these solutions lies in their cost-effectiveness, flexibility, and potential for innovation. Organizations can avoid expensive licensing fees associated with commercial platforms while benefiting from the collective expertise of open-source communities. Historically, these options have gained traction as data analysis needs have evolved, prompting a demand for adaptable and scalable tools. Their distributed development model often results in rapid feature additions and security updates, driven by a global network of contributors.

The following sections will delve into specific open-source tools that offer similar data visualization and analysis capabilities, examining their features, benefits, and considerations for implementation within diverse organizational settings. The exploration will include a comparative analysis of functionality, ease of use, and community support, providing a comprehensive overview of available options.

1. Cost-effectiveness

The economic implications of selecting a business intelligence platform are significant for organizations of all sizes. Opting for solutions lacking proprietary licensing can substantially reduce the total cost of ownership compared to commercially licensed software.

  • Elimination of Licensing Fees

    Proprietary software often involves per-user or per-core licensing models, resulting in considerable and recurring expenses. Open-source alternatives, by their nature, eliminate these fees, offering a significant initial and ongoing cost reduction. This is particularly beneficial for organizations with a large number of users or extensive data processing requirements.

  • Reduced Infrastructure Costs

    Certain commercial business intelligence tools require specialized hardware or operating systems, further contributing to infrastructure expenses. Many open-source solutions are designed to operate on commodity hardware and widely supported operating systems, minimizing infrastructure costs. Cloud-based deployment options also contribute to reducing infrastructure overhead.

  • Lower Training and Support Costs

    While proprietary software vendors often provide paid training and support services, the open-source community offers extensive documentation, tutorials, and forums. This community-driven support can significantly reduce reliance on expensive vendor-provided support, lowering overall training and support costs. However, internal expertise might be required for complex implementations.

  • Avoidance of Vendor Lock-In

    Proprietary software can lead to vendor lock-in, where migrating to another platform becomes costly and complex due to data format incompatibilities and proprietary features. Open-source solutions often utilize open standards and data formats, facilitating easier migration and reducing reliance on a single vendor. This flexibility contributes to long-term cost-effectiveness.

The cost advantages associated with open-source alternatives extend beyond mere financial savings. The flexibility and community support contribute to a more agile and responsive data analysis environment, ultimately enhancing an organization’s ability to derive insights and make informed decisions without incurring excessive costs.

2. Customization Potential

The capacity to modify and extend software functionality represents a key differentiator between proprietary and open-source solutions. In the context of business intelligence and data visualization, this adaptability holds particular importance. Open-source alternatives offer organizations the potential to tailor the platform to specific data sources, analytical requirements, and user interfaces, thus enabling a closer alignment with business needs than may be achievable with off-the-shelf commercial options. This level of control over the software’s behavior stems directly from the availability of the source code.

One practical application of this customization potential involves integrating with niche or legacy data systems that lack native support in proprietary platforms. Organizations can develop custom connectors or data ingestion pipelines to bridge these gaps, ensuring comprehensive data coverage. Furthermore, specific calculations, visualizations, or reporting templates can be implemented to address unique analytical demands. For example, a financial institution might customize an open-source business intelligence tool to incorporate proprietary risk models and regulatory reporting requirements. Similarly, a scientific research organization could tailor the platform to visualize complex experimental data in a domain-specific manner.

Ultimately, the customization potential inherent in open-source business intelligence alternatives empowers organizations to create bespoke data solutions that perfectly fit their unique circumstances. While this requires internal technical expertise or the engagement of specialized consultants, the resulting flexibility and control can provide a significant competitive advantage. The ability to adapt the software to evolving needs also ensures its long-term relevance and value, mitigating the risk of obsolescence associated with proprietary platforms. However, organizations must carefully manage the complexity of customizations to ensure maintainability and avoid introducing instability.

3. Community Support

Community support is a critical factor in the viability and sustainability of open-source software, particularly for organizations considering alternatives to commercial platforms for data visualization and business intelligence. A robust community provides essential resources, knowledge, and collaborative problem-solving, impacting the overall success of implementation and long-term maintenance.

  • Documentation and Knowledge Base

    Open-source projects thrive on community-contributed documentation, including tutorials, FAQs, and best-practice guides. These resources often provide a more accessible and practical learning experience than vendor-provided documentation. For a data visualization alternative, comprehensive documentation empowers users to effectively utilize the software’s features, troubleshoot issues, and develop custom solutions. A strong knowledge base reduces the reliance on formal training, lowering the barrier to entry for new users.

  • Forums and Online Discussion

    Active forums and online discussion platforms provide a space for users to connect, share knowledge, and seek assistance from peers and experienced contributors. These platforms are invaluable for resolving specific issues, gaining insights into different use cases, and contributing to the overall development of the software. A vibrant community fosters a collaborative environment where users can learn from each other and contribute to the collective knowledge base. This peer-to-peer support is especially valuable for complex configurations and customizations often required in enterprise environments.

  • Bug Reporting and Feature Requests

    Open-source communities rely on user feedback to identify and address bugs, security vulnerabilities, and areas for improvement. Community members actively report issues and submit feature requests, contributing to the ongoing development and refinement of the software. This collaborative approach ensures that the platform evolves to meet the needs of its users. A responsive community addresses reported issues promptly, enhancing the reliability and security of the data visualization solution.

  • Community-Driven Development

    Many open-source projects embrace a community-driven development model, where contributors from around the world collaborate to improve the software. This collaborative approach can lead to faster development cycles, more innovative features, and a broader range of perspectives than a single vendor could provide. Users can actively participate in the development process by contributing code, testing new features, and providing feedback on design decisions. This level of involvement ensures that the data visualization platform remains relevant and responsive to the evolving needs of its user base.

The strength and responsiveness of community support are paramount when evaluating open-source alternatives. The availability of comprehensive documentation, active forums, efficient bug reporting, and community-driven development significantly impacts the long-term viability and success of a chosen solution. Organizations must assess the community’s activity, responsiveness, and the availability of experienced contributors before committing to an open-source alternative.

4. Data Security

Data security represents a paramount concern for any organization leveraging business intelligence and data visualization tools. When considering a non-proprietary substitute, the implications for data security warrant careful assessment. The open-source nature of these alternatives inherently grants access to the source code, potentially exposing vulnerabilities to malicious actors if not rigorously maintained. A dedicated security strategy is thus crucial. Failure to implement robust security measures can lead to data breaches, compromising sensitive information and negatively impacting organizational reputation and compliance with data protection regulations. For instance, a healthcare provider implementing an open-source visualization tool must ensure HIPAA compliance through encryption, access controls, and audit trails. Similarly, a financial institution must adhere to PCI DSS standards when handling payment card data within the open-source environment.

A critical aspect of ensuring data security within the context of these substitutes involves regular security audits and penetration testing. Given the collaborative nature of open-source development, vulnerabilities can be identified and addressed more rapidly than in closed-source environments, provided an active security community exists. Organizations must actively participate in the community, reporting vulnerabilities and contributing to security patches. The selection of an open-source alternative should include an evaluation of the community’s track record in addressing security concerns and the frequency of security updates. Furthermore, organizations should implement robust access controls, encryption mechanisms, and data masking techniques to protect sensitive data at rest and in transit. Examples include using Transport Layer Security (TLS) for secure data transmission, implementing role-based access control (RBAC) to restrict data access based on user roles, and encrypting sensitive data fields within the database.

In summary, while non-proprietary options offer potential cost savings and customization benefits, they require a heightened focus on data security. Proactive security measures, regular audits, community engagement, and adherence to relevant data protection standards are essential to mitigate the risks associated with open-source vulnerabilities. The decision to adopt such a solution should be based on a comprehensive risk assessment and a commitment to implementing and maintaining a robust security posture. The trade-off between cost savings and potential security risks must be carefully considered, ensuring that data security remains a top priority.

5. Feature Parity

Feature parity represents a critical consideration when evaluating open-source business intelligence platforms as replacements for established commercial solutions. The extent to which an alternative can replicate the functionalities of a tool like Tableau directly impacts its suitability for organizations seeking to migrate without disrupting existing workflows or sacrificing analytical capabilities.

  • Data Connectivity

    The ability to connect to a diverse range of data sources is paramount. Tableau supports connections to numerous databases, cloud services, and file formats. An open-source alternative must offer comparable connectivity options to ensure seamless integration with existing data infrastructure. If an alternative lacks native support for a critical data source, organizations must invest in custom connectors or ETL processes, potentially negating cost savings. For instance, if an organization heavily relies on data stored in a specific NoSQL database supported by Tableau but not directly supported by the alternative, this constitutes a significant gap in feature parity.

  • Visualization Capabilities

    Tableau is recognized for its extensive library of chart types, interactive dashboards, and drag-and-drop interface. An open-source alternative must provide a similar range of visualization options to effectively communicate data insights. The absence of specific chart types or interactive features can hinder the ability to replicate existing dashboards and reports. Consider the use case of advanced geospatial analysis; if the alternative lacks the robust mapping capabilities found in Tableau, organizations requiring such analysis may find the alternative inadequate.

  • Data Transformation and Modeling

    Tableau provides tools for data cleaning, transformation, and modeling, allowing users to prepare data for analysis. An open-source alternative must offer equivalent functionalities to ensure data quality and consistency. If the alternative lacks features like data blending, calculated fields, or data pivoting, users may need to rely on external tools for data preparation, increasing complexity. A business, for example, may need to perform complex calculations on its sales data like cohort analysis if the alternative do not support it.

  • Collaboration and Sharing

    Tableau facilitates collaboration through features like shared workbooks, commenting, and user permissions. An open-source alternative must provide comparable collaboration features to enable seamless teamwork. The absence of features like version control, role-based access control, or embedded analytics can limit the ability to share insights and collaborate effectively. Teams needing to share live dashboards with external stakeholders may struggle if the feature alternative does not provide embedded analytics.

The pursuit of feature parity is not simply about replicating every function of Tableau. Organizations must prioritize the features that are most critical to their specific analytical needs and workflows. A thorough assessment of feature gaps is essential to determine whether the benefits of an open-source alternative outweigh the potential challenges of adapting to a different set of tools. Organizations should evaluate each alternatives capability, user interface, and community support.

6. Scalability

Scalability, in the context of business intelligence tools, refers to the ability of a system to handle increasing amounts of data, users, and complexity without experiencing a significant degradation in performance. When considering open-source alternatives, scalability becomes a critical evaluation criterion. Commercial solutions like Tableau are designed and optimized for enterprise-level scalability, often incorporating proprietary technologies and dedicated infrastructure. Open-source alternatives must demonstrate comparable scalability to effectively serve large organizations with extensive data analysis needs. Inadequate scalability can manifest as slow query response times, dashboard rendering delays, and system instability, ultimately hindering the ability to derive timely insights from data. A financial institution processing millions of transactions daily, for example, requires a system capable of efficiently handling this volume of data while providing rapid access to key performance indicators.

The scalability of an open-source data visualization solution is influenced by several factors, including its architecture, database integration capabilities, and support for distributed computing. Solutions designed with a modular architecture can be scaled horizontally by adding more servers or nodes to the cluster. Efficient database connectors and query optimization techniques are essential for minimizing query execution times. Support for distributed computing frameworks, such as Apache Spark, allows for parallel processing of large datasets, significantly improving performance. Organizations must carefully assess the scalability characteristics of potential open-source alternatives, considering both vertical scaling (increasing the resources of a single server) and horizontal scaling (distributing the workload across multiple servers). Furthermore, it’s crucial to evaluate the ease of scaling the system as data volumes and user base grow over time. For instance, an e-commerce company experiencing rapid growth needs a system that can easily scale to accommodate increasing data from online transactions and customer interactions.

In conclusion, scalability is a non-negotiable requirement for organizations considering open-source alternatives. A system’s inability to scale can negate the cost benefits and customization options associated with open-source solutions. Organizations should conduct thorough performance testing and benchmarking to ensure that the chosen alternative can meet their current and future scalability needs. The long-term viability of an open-source data visualization solution hinges on its ability to scale efficiently and reliably as data volumes and user demand increase. Properly evaluating and addressing scalability ensures the data visualization tool can serve a growing organization without compromising performance, data delivery and insight.

Frequently Asked Questions

This section addresses common inquiries regarding the use of open-source platforms as substitutes for Tableau software in data visualization and business intelligence.

Question 1: What defines a software option as a genuine open-source alternative in this context?

A genuine open-source alternative provides business intelligence and data visualization capabilities under an open-source license. This typically entails the software’s source code being freely accessible, modifiable, and distributable, in compliance with the terms of the chosen open-source license (e.g., Apache 2.0, GPL). The license grants users considerable autonomy in how the software is utilized and deployed.

Question 2: Are open-source substitutes truly cost-effective for enterprise deployments, considering the potential need for internal support?

While the elimination of licensing fees is a primary cost advantage, the total cost of ownership necessitates consideration of internal expertise. Organizations may require personnel proficient in software installation, configuration, customization, and maintenance. However, even with these support costs, the absence of recurring license expenses often renders open-source options economically competitive for large-scale deployments.

Question 3: How can data security be assured when utilizing open-source platforms in contrast to proprietary options?

Data security in open-source environments hinges on proactive measures, including regular security audits, vulnerability scanning, and timely application of security patches. Active participation in the open-source community is crucial for identifying and addressing potential vulnerabilities. Organizations must also implement robust access controls, encryption mechanisms, and data governance policies to safeguard sensitive information.

Question 4: To what extent do these alternatives replicate the feature set found in Tableau software?

Feature parity varies among different open-source alternatives. Some solutions offer a comprehensive suite of data visualization and analysis tools, while others may prioritize specific functionalities. A thorough evaluation of feature alignment with an organization’s requirements is essential. Key considerations include data connectivity, visualization capabilities, data transformation features, and collaboration tools.

Question 5: How does community support contribute to the long-term viability of an open-source analytics platform?

Community support plays a pivotal role in the sustainability of open-source projects. Active communities provide access to documentation, forums, and expert guidance, facilitating problem-solving and knowledge sharing. A vibrant community contributes to bug fixes, security updates, and feature enhancements, ensuring the ongoing development and improvement of the platform.

Question 6: What considerations are important for ensuring scalability of this type of software, particularly as data volumes grow?

Scalability requires a system design capable of efficiently handling increasing data volumes and user loads. Factors include the underlying architecture, database integration capabilities, and support for distributed computing frameworks. Horizontal scalability, involving the addition of more servers, is often necessary for large datasets. Organizations should conduct performance testing to validate scalability under realistic workloads.

The effective utilization of open-source substitutes requires a comprehensive understanding of the technical considerations, security implications, and community dynamics associated with these platforms. A careful assessment of organizational needs and resources is paramount.

The subsequent section will explore real-world case studies illustrating the successful implementation of these options in various industries.

Tips for Evaluating Tableau Software Open Source Alternatives

Selecting a business intelligence platform requires careful consideration of organizational needs and available resources. These tips provide guidance for evaluating open-source alternatives to Tableau Software, ensuring a well-informed decision.

Tip 1: Define Requirements Precisely:

Clearly articulate the specific data visualization and analysis requirements of the organization. Identify key performance indicators (KPIs), reporting needs, and user roles. A comprehensive requirements document serves as a benchmark for evaluating the suitability of each potential alternative. For example, an organization needing advanced geospatial analysis should prioritize solutions with robust mapping capabilities.

Tip 2: Assess Data Connectivity Options:

Verify that the open-source alternative supports connections to all relevant data sources. This includes databases, cloud services, and file formats currently in use. Insufficient data connectivity necessitates the development of custom connectors or ETL processes, potentially increasing complexity and costs. Organizations relying on specific data sources, such as SAP HANA or Salesforce, must confirm compatibility.

Tip 3: Evaluate Visualization Capabilities:

Compare the range of chart types, interactive features, and dashboard customization options offered by the alternative to those available in Tableau. Ensure that the alternative can effectively communicate data insights in a clear and compelling manner. Organizations requiring specific visualization types, such as treemaps or scatter plots, should verify their availability.

Tip 4: Examine Data Transformation Features:

Assess the alternative’s ability to perform data cleaning, transformation, and modeling tasks. This includes data blending, calculated fields, and data pivoting. Adequate data transformation capabilities are essential for ensuring data quality and consistency. Organizations working with complex datasets should prioritize solutions with robust data transformation functionalities.

Tip 5: Investigate Community Support:

Evaluate the strength and responsiveness of the open-source community supporting the alternative. Look for active forums, comprehensive documentation, and readily available support resources. A vibrant community contributes to bug fixes, security updates, and feature enhancements. Organizations should assess the community’s history of addressing security concerns and the availability of experienced contributors.

Tip 6: Conduct Scalability Testing:

Perform thorough performance testing to ensure that the alternative can handle current and future data volumes and user loads. This includes testing query response times, dashboard rendering speeds, and system stability under peak conditions. Organizations processing large datasets should prioritize solutions with proven scalability capabilities.

Tip 7: Review Security Features:

Carefully assess the security features offered by the alternative, including access controls, encryption mechanisms, and audit logging. Organizations must implement robust security measures to protect sensitive data from unauthorized access and breaches. Organizations subject to regulatory compliance requirements, such as HIPAA or PCI DSS, should verify that the alternative meets applicable standards.

These tips provide a framework for evaluating business intelligence tools, helping to ensure a cost-effective and secure data analysis solution.

The next section concludes with a review of the critical points presented, reinforcing key considerations for effective decision-making.

Conclusion

The exploration of a Tableau software open source alternative reveals a landscape marked by potential benefits and inherent challenges. Cost reduction, customization, and community-driven development represent key advantages. However, the importance of stringent data security, adherence to scalability demands, and thorough verification of feature parity necessitates careful consideration. The absence of proprietary licensing does not equate to a risk-free solution, and organizations must thoroughly assess their internal capabilities and resource allocation to ensure successful implementation and long-term sustainability.

The selection of a business intelligence platform remains a strategic decision with significant implications for data-driven decision-making. A comprehensive understanding of the trade-offs between commercial and open-source solutions is paramount. The future effectiveness of data analysis within an organization depends on a well-informed choice, aligned with organizational goals and a commitment to maintaining a robust data infrastructure. Therefore, the pursuit of an alternative should be undertaken with diligence and a clear understanding of the responsibilities involved.